I was in a similar situation a few years back and decided to gain more experience in a different field of work by assisting a number of charities on a voluntary basis.

This gave me a feeling of purpose
I learnt new skills
And, voluntary work while unemployed always looks good on a CV

Just make sure that you run it bu your benefits agency first as there are restrictions on how many hours you can work voluntary and the fact that you need to be contactable in case a suitable job crops up in some countries.

Also, if you are feeling depressed, speak to your doc. They will understand and there are a number of different medications available that can take the edge off your anxiety and depression.

Lastly, exercise! No matter how hard it may be to motivate yourself, this will generate 'feel good' chemicals in your brain and keep you fit at the same time.

Good Luck and don't give up hope.
